Output 12664edae546b79171b5928fbc3443793a6d90cd60a645854703239945f8a29b:18

value
10304
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f68c1a33b8baf7b22dbc82b341afe1995e1491c2 OP_EQUALVERIFY OP_CHECKSIG
address
1PUd4fzjzvoBvRGpEL2wAE59gjfxtdT69H
transaction
12664edae546b79171b5928fbc3443793a6d90cd60a645854703239945f8a29b
spent
true